Iteration Without the Implementation of Loops

I am interested in being able to run this particular code using i as the iterating vector. While this can easily be accomplished using a for-loop, I would like to do this without using loops of any kind. Essentially what I want is for the vector q to contain all ten values of F when q is solved for a given i-value. The issue currently is that F does not take any value of i, so I am left with an empty x-matrix in the end. I want to iterate for each value of i in the vector, but without using loops. Does anybody have any suggestions?
%%%Test program
%%Clear variables
close all;
clear all;
clc;
%%Definitions
syms q
x = [];
i = 1:10;
F = i - 2*q == 0;
solq = solve(F,q);
x = (x,solq)
